Experience from Golf Courses in Pebble Beach, CA

The team had the opportunity to play at three distinct golf courses during their trip. Here's a brief overview of each course:

1.   Pebble Beach Golf Links:

The green fee at Pebble Beach Golf Links is excessively steep (with an additional requirement of reserving a hotel room for a minimum of $600 per night to secure a tee time in advance). The pace of play may not be the fastest, and the opening hole may be lackluster. However, the breathtaking landscape, the storied history of golf played on its fairways and greens, and the immeasurable wow factor make it an invaluable experience that every serious golfer should have at least once.

2.  The Links at Spanish Bay:

The course starts with an exceptional par-5 hole, offering a breathtaking view of Spanish Bay from its green. While some purists argue that the presence of woods, wetlands, and forced carries detracts from its classification as a true links course. The presence of a gentle breeze, firm turf, and a bagpiper playing his tune along the first fairway at twilight create an ambiance reminiscent of Scotland—albeit with added luxury that the Scots never experienced.

3.   Spyglass Golf Course:

Spyglass, always known as the toughest course utilized in the AT&T Pebble Beach Pro-Am, impresses immediately with its breathtaking sea views, mesmerizing dunes, and thrilling elevation changes on the first five holes. As if that weren't enough, it further intensifies the challenge on the back nine, which is heavily wooded and somewhat less dramatic. Considered the most demanding among the trio of courses, Spyglass truly delivers a memorable and demanding golfing experience. While it boasts a handful of scenic holes along the water, most of the course is nestled within a picturesque wooded forest area.

While Pebble Beach Golf Links provided breathtaking views and Spanish Bay had its own allure, Spyglass was regarded as the least favorite due to its narrower fairways and limited coastal exposure.

 

Double-Bag Caddies at the Courses

During their Spanish Bay, Spyglass, and Pebble Beach Golf Links rounds, the team had double-bag caddies. Unlike in Scotland and Ireland, where caddies typically carry both bags, here, carts are available for use. However, the caddies still assist by running back and forth, bringing clubs and other items as needed. This system allows players to have the convenience of a cart while still benefiting from the caddies' local knowledge and support. The presence of carts and the back-and-forth movement of the caddies may have contributed to the longer duration of the rounds.

Caddy Tips

Based on the information found on the Pebble Beach Golf Links website, it was suggested to tip the caddies between $75 and $100. To ensure consistency, the participants were advised to tip a minimum of $100 per caddy. They could tip more if they felt the caddies deserved it or had an exceptional experience. Having this suggested tipping range provided a helpful guideline, as it's not always easy to determine an appropriate amount. It's important for pro shops and golf clubs to be clear about the minimum tip for basic service to avoid any confusion.
